Finding the time to squeeze in a workout each day is hard as it is, and this is precisely why one company thought of completely eliminating the half an hour or more needed to exercise. However, that’s not to say that there will be no workout at all – quite on the contrary, thanks to the
BodyTogs Wearable Weights, we can work the muscles on our body for the entire duration of the day and get better results in a shorter time, the manufacturers ensure.
The BodyTogs are actually fitted, customized sleeves that come with incorporated weights that are evenly distributed. Worn on the arms or legs, they can make any action harder than it would be under normal circumstances (from walking to lifting a cup of coffee to take a sip), thus engaging the muscles more and, in turn, burning more calories and leading to a faster weight loss. Although BodyTogs are supposedly harmless if used according to instructions and only after seeing a doctor in case of certain health conditions, not all trainers are ecstatic about the idea. Working out during specially designated times is the only healthy approach to weight loss, they say, because it gives the body enough time to recover from the strain. Moreover, assigning a special hour to break a sweat also means taking a break from everything else in our daily life, which also makes it a very good stress reliever. Putting a strain on the muscles all day long fits in neither of these two.
“Performing strength training exercises that are specifically designed to target certain muscles are excellent for your body. When you use correct form, and the appropriate amount of weight, there is little risk of injury. On the other hand, carrying around extra weight on your arms and legs while going about your day may burn extra calories, but it will also increase your risk for a torn muscle or injury to your joint. Just like walking with dumbbells or ankle weight is a big no-no, you don’t want to do regular activities while carrying weights because it puts too much stress on your body. If you want to burn extra calories during your day, fit in an extra 30 minutes of cardio.”
FitSugar says.
